Cougars named to All-State Teams

The accolades continue for several Patrick County High athletes with the announcement of the Class 2 All-State baseball and softball teams.

For Tucker Swails, it’s back-to-back years being named to the All-State first team as a pitcher, capping off a senior season that also saw him named district and region player of the year, in addition to being named 1st Team all-region and all-district at pitcher and shortstop.

Stuart Callahan was named 1st Team All-State as an outfielder. In addition, Callahan was named to the district and region 1st team as an outfielder and 2nd team all-district and all-region as a pitcher.

Lady Cougar Journey Moore capped off her terrific season being named 1st Team All-State as a catcher. Moore was named Region 2C player of the year and 1st Team All-Region and 1st team all-district at catcher.
